Infleqtion has signed a Letter of Intent with the @commercegov CHIPS Research and Development Office for $100 million in proposed funding to accelerate U.S.-based quantum computing technologies critical to economic competitiveness and national security. “Quantum computing is emerging as a foundational technology for economic competitiveness, technological leadership, and national security,” said Matt Kinsella, Chief Executive Officer of Infleqtion. “This investment reflects the transformative potential of quantum innovation, and we’re honored to work with the Department of Commerce to accelerate U.S. leadership in quantum computing.” The proposed investment supports the advancement of neutral-atom quantum systems across quantum hardware, photonics and full-stack system development, while strengthening domestic quantum manufacturing, supply chain and workforce capabilities. Infleqtion’s quantum technologies are already supporting programs across national security, energy, and scientific research, including @DARPA, the @Energy, @NASA, and the @DeptofWar. “NVIDIA and Infleqtion have long worked together to accelerate the capability of quantum computing through integration of quantum processors with GPU supercomputing,” said Timothy Costa, Vice President and General Manager for Quantum at @NVIDIA. “This announcement is an important milestone for developing large-scale quantum computing systems in the United States, and we're excited to continue supporting Infleqtion on this journey.” Read the full announcement: ow.ly/FcOQ50Z2CSk

Infleqtion's Tiqker optical atomic clock integrates with Safran's SecureSync to deliver a new level of precision in time and frequency synchronization. By combining SecureSync's long-term accuracy with Tiqker's short-term stability, the architecture maintains sub-nanosecond synchronization across distributed networks for resilient, high-accuracy timing infrastructure with real-world applications in fintech, data centers, defense, and quantum technologies. Congratulations to Infleqtion Chief Scientist Dr. Mark Saffman and co-recipient Dr. Antoine Browaeys on accepting the 2026 Norman F. Ramsey Prize at DAMOP this week, awarded for seminal contributions to quantum information processing with neutral atoms. Mark's pioneering work on Rydberg-mediated entanglement and high-fidelity two-qubit operations helped establish neutral atoms as a leading platform for scalable quantum computing. As militaries contend with increasingly contested airwaves, NextGen Defense took a closer look at Infleqtion's Quantum Spectrum platform and what atom-based RF sensing means for operations in jammed and GPS-denied environments. Read the full article to learn how Rydberg atoms detect signals across the full RF spectrum in a single aperture, and get to know the U.S. Army program working to bring that capability to the field: nextgendefense.com/infleqtio…
